RepDB is a one-time-purchase exercise dataset for developers building fitness and workout apps โ€” not a subscription, not a rate-limited API. You download the data once and own it: JSON (and SQLite on the higher tier), WebP images, and full EN/DE/ES translations, with no per-request billing and no dependency on our servers staying up.

A free tier includes 250 exercises with flat-style 512ร—512 images, attribution-licensed for commercial in-app use. The Starter tier ($199) adds the full catalog in classic white-background style. Standard ($399) adds transparent 1024px images, looping animations, exercise relations (similar/progressions/regressions), workout templates, and embeddings โ€” exclusive to that tier.

Every exercise includes muscle-group highlighting, equipment/muscle icons, MET values, and safety/goal tags. Compared to GIF- or JPG-based competitor APIs, RepDB images are transparent WebP with no watermarks, so they drop into any app UI without a white box around them.

Metlo API Security features and specs

  • Comprehensive Security Features
    Metlo API Security offers a wide range of security features designed to protect APIs from various threats, including anomaly detection, rate limiting, and IP blacklisting.
  • Ease of Integration
    The platform is designed to be easily integrated with existing API infrastructures, reducing the time and effort needed to implement its security measures.
  • Real-Time Monitoring
    Metlo provides real-time monitoring of API traffic, enabling quick detection and response to potential security breaches.
  • Detailed Reporting and Analytics
    The platform offers extensive reporting and analytics capabilities, allowing users to gain insights into API usage patterns and potential vulnerabilities.
  • Scalability
    Metlo is designed to handle high volumes of API traffic, making it suitable for businesses of all sizes, from startups to large enterprises.

Possible disadvantages of Metlo API Security

  • Cost
    Depending on the scale of deployment, the cost of using Metlo API Security can be significant, especially for smaller businesses or startups with limited budgets.
  • Complexity
    While offering a comprehensive set of features, Metlo can be complex to set up and manage, potentially requiring dedicated personnel for optimal operation.
  • Learning Curve
    New users may face a steep learning curve when getting accustomed to the platform's extensive features and functionalities.
  • Dependency on Third-Party Service
    Relying on a third-party solution for API security might not align with all organizations' strategies, especially those with policies against external dependencies.
  • Potential Overhead
    Integrating Metlo might introduce some overhead in API performance, which needs to be monitored and managed, particularly under high load conditions.

What's the story behind your product?

RepDB's answer:

RepDB grew out of a consumer workout app its creator was building solo. Sourcing exercise images and data meant either paying for a subscription API with usage caps and no caching rights, or producing everything from scratch. The illustrated, multi-language dataset was built for us first, then split out as its own product once it became clear other indie developers had the same problem and preferred to buy the data outright rather than rent it through an API.
